Few Shot Adaptation Techniques

2025-11-11

Introduction

Few-shot adaptation techniques sit at the practical nexus of modern AI: you have powerful, general models, and you need them to perform well in a specific task, domain, or brand voice with only a handful of examples. The core idea is simple in spirit—teach the model to behave as if it has seen a few carefully chosen demonstrations—yet the engineering and product decisions around these techniques are anything but trivial. In production, few-shot adaptation is how teams scale personalized experiences, maintain safety and consistency, and keep up with changing requirements without re-training massive models from scratch. Across products like ChatGPT, Gemini, Claude, Mistral-powered assistants, Copilot, Midjourney, and Whisper-enabled workflows, practitioners exploit few-shot strategies to bridge the gap between broad language capabilities and domain-specific usefulness. This masterclass will connect the dots between theory, system design, and real-world deployment so you can move from concepts to concrete, repeatable results in your own teams and projects.


What makes few-shot adaptation compelling in practice is not just performance, but velocity. You can prototype a new capability with a handful of prompts, validate it with real users, and then iterate rapidly. You can combine prompts with lightweight adapters or retrieval systems to keep the model’s knowledge fresh without incurring the heavy cost of full fine-tuning. And you can design your product stack so that a single, well-crafted adaptation layer serves many tasks, locales, and personas—while preserving privacy, safety, and governance. In short, few-shot adaptation is a practical toolkit for turning general intelligence into dependable,域-specific, production-ready capabilities.


Applied Context & Problem Statement

In real-world systems, the challenge is rarely “do I have a powerful model?” and more “can I make the model speak the language of our users, respect our policies, and stay current with domain knowledge, all with minimal data and predictable costs?” Consider a customer support assistant deployed for a multinational bank. The model must answer with accurate policy references, maintain a brand voice, avoid disclosing PII, and handle multilingual inquiries. A one-size-fits-all prompt will fail; a few-shot strategy must weave in policy snippets, tone guidelines, and persona constraints while remaining efficient. Another scenario involves a software-team assistant like Copilot that needs to align with a company’s internal code conventions, documentation, and security practices. Here, few-shot adaptation is not just a nicety—it’s essential for trust, compliance, and developer productivity.


Data pipelines and engineering constraints magnify the complexity. You typically need a lean data loop: collect representative task demonstrations, curate high-quality prompts, and evaluate outcomes in production. You must balance latency against accuracy, cost against throughput, and privacy against personalization. Retrieval-augmented approaches help keep knowledge up-to-date by pulling in current documents or policy updates, but they introduce system complexity: a vector store, embedding generation, and a mechanism to fuse retrieved content with the prompt. Across platforms such as OpenAI’s ChatGPT, Claude, Gemini, and specialized products like DeepSeek or Whisper-enabled workflows, teams stitch together prompt templates, adapters, and retrieval layers to create robust, mission-critical capabilities with limited new data each sprint.


Another recurring problem is drift and safety. Domain policies change, regulatory requirements evolve, and user expectations shift. Few-shot strategies must accommodate ongoing changes without retraining, while preserving safe and compliant behavior. This means thoughtful prompt design, modular adaptation layers, and transparent monitoring. The business impact is clear: faster time-to-value for new capabilities, better alignment with enterprise needs, and the ability to test, roll back, and observe outcomes with minimal risk. That’s why production teams lean heavily on a mix of in-context learning, parameter-efficient fine-tuning, and retrieval-based augmentation rather than relying solely on blanket fine-tuning of a large model for every new task.


Core Concepts & Practical Intuition

At the heart of few-shot adaptation is the idea of guiding a powerful model with examples, context, and structure so that it behaves as if it has specialized training for a task. In-context learning—where you supply a few demonstrations in the prompt—lets you steer the model without updating its weights. The craft here is subtle: choosing the right examples, ordering them effectively, and providing a clear instruction set or system prompt that establishes the model’s role and constraints. The practical benefit is immense: you can pilot a new capability in days rather than months, and you can switch contexts rapidly by altering the prompt rather than reconfiguring an entire training pipeline. In production, teams experiment with few-shot prompts to establish baseline behavior and then layer in additional mechanisms to improve reliability, such as chaining prompts with follow-up questions or including explicit reasoning steps when appropriate.


To scale beyond ephemeral prompts, practitioners deploy prompt tuning or adapters. Prompt tuning learns a small set of continuous tokens that steer the model, while adapters insert lightweight, trainable modules into a frozen base model. Prefix-tuning and LoRA (Low-Rank Adaptation) are popular variants. The intuition is straightforward: you keep the heavy model weights fixed, train a compact, task-specific module, and compose it with the base model at inference. This dramatically lowers the compute and storage footprint when you have many domains, languages, or user segments, making enterprise deployment feasible. In real systems, you might maintain a single base model for broad capability and attach multiple adapters corresponding to different verticals—using a single inference path with a switchable, pluggable adaptation layer. This pattern is common in AI-powered copilots or customer-support agents that must work across product domains while keeping costs predictable.


Retrieval-augmented generation adds another dimension. By retrieving relevant documents or knowledge chunks and injecting them into the prompt or the model’s context, you can keep facts current and domain-specific without retraining on every new document. Companies deploying tools like DeepSeek or internal knowledge bases often pair a vector database (embedding-based) with a lightweight reader or an LLM prompt that concatenates retrieved snippets with your user query. The practical impact is clear: you reduce hallucinations for facts that live in static corpora or fresh policies, and you can tailor responses to regulatory or product-specific content on the fly. The trade-off is architectural complexity and latency, which means careful design around indexing, caching, and retrieval routing to avoid bottlenecks in high-velocity environments.


Instruction tuning and multi-task learning provide a broader backbone for few-shot adaptation. Instruction-tuned models learn to follow explicit directions, which makes them more predictable in a production setting. When combined with few-shot demonstrations, instruction-tuned models can generalize to new tasks with fewer examples because they already have a robust prior for following user intents. In practice, teams leverage this by pairing an instruction-tuned base with a domain-specific adapter or retrieval layer, ensuring the system remains flexible yet bounded by policy. A practical takeaway is to design your product prompts with explicit roles, constraints, and success criteria, and then let lightweight adaptation layers handle domain specialization. This layered approach mirrors how enterprise-grade assistants evolve: a strong generalist core, a task-specific adaptation layer, and a retrieval layer that anchors the model to current knowledge.


Data quality and safety shape what works. Few-shot methods rely on representative demonstrations; if those demonstrations encode biased reasoning, the model can reproduce it. In production, teams implement guardrails, content policies, and safety checks that sit between the user, the prompt, and the model. They also monitor for prompt leakage, where tasks or policies appear in the prompt history, and for drift, where prompts become stale relative to user needs or regulations. The engineering discipline here is as important as the ML technique: prompt templates are versioned like code, content governance is automated, and there is a feedback loop from users to improve demonstrations. When well-executed, few-shot adaptation becomes a dependable lever for compliance, trust, and user satisfaction across diverse products—from chat agents to multimodal content generation platforms like Midjourney and video or audio transcriptions with Whisper.


Engineering Perspective

The engineering backbone of few-shot adaptation is a clean separation of concerns that allows teams to evolve capabilities without destabilizing the system. A typical architecture starts with a Prompt Engine that encapsulates templates, demonstrations, and system prompts. This engine must be able to assemble prompts dynamically, selecting demonstrations via a careful curation strategy, possibly guided by similarity to the current user query or diversity to cover edge cases. A separate Retrieval Layer introduces a Vector Store that indexes domain documents, policy manuals, and codebases; this layer feeds fresh facts into the prompt, often through a retrieval-augmented prompt that includes both the question and relevant excerpts. This separation enables teams to swap or upgrade retrieval sources without reworking the core model usage, a pattern you see in production-grade assistants that stay current with policies or code repositories.


On the model side, most deployments employ parameter-efficient tuning techniques to tailor the system to a domain while keeping the heavy model weights frozen. LoRA adapters, prefix-tuning, or small trainable modules can be attached per domain or per customer segment. In a multi-tenant product, you’d typically maintain a shared base model and compose domain adapters on demand. This approach keeps storage and compute costs in check and makes it feasible to roll out dozens of domain-specific capabilities with minimal retraining. You also need a versioned catalog of adapters, with well-defined compatibility boundaries, so you can test and rollback changes safely. The practical payoff is clear: faster onboarding of new capabilities, predictable costs, and a robust governance trail as you scale.


From an operations perspective, latency and throughput matter as you integrate generation with retrieval. Caching frequently used prompt templates and retrieved snippets reduces round trips to the model. If your product experiences burst traffic, you might deploy multiple parallel inference paths or use a tiered approach where lightweight prompts run through a cheaper, cached pathway and more complex prompts route to the full model. This is a common pattern in Copilot-like experiences that need to generate code quickly at scale or in chat interfaces that must support many concurrent users. Another practical consideration is privacy: design prompts and adapters to minimize sensitive data exposure, employ anonymization where possible, and consider on-device or edge adaptation for highly sensitive domains where data residency rules apply.


Quality assurance in few-shot systems involves a blend of automated testing, human-in-the-loop evaluation, and continuous monitoring. You’ll want to define success criteria aligned with real business goals—accuracy of facts, adherence to tone, adherence to safety constraints, and user satisfaction metrics. A/B testing is crucial: compare different prompt templates, adapter configurations, or retrieval sources to quantify impact on outcomes like conversion rate, time-to-resolution, or user engagement. Observability channels—prompt versioning, adapter versioning, retrieval index health, and latency dashboards—are essential for diagnosing regressions and guiding iterative improvements. In practice, teams iterate through fast cycles: deploy a prompt or adapter, measure, learn, and roll back if needed, all while maintaining a stable user experience for live customers.


Real-World Use Cases

Consider an enterprise chatbot for a financial services firm. The system leverages few-shot prompts to interpret policy questions, use a brand voice, and cite policy documents retrieved from an internal knowledge base. By pairing in-context demonstrations with a policy-aware system prompt and a retrieval layer, the model can answer with authority while ensuring that references are up to date. The result is a significant reduction in escalation to human agents and faster response times for routine inquiries. Across platforms like ChatGPT and Claude, this approach enables a scalable, compliant experience that still feels personalized to each user context.


A practical, code-focused scenario is a developer assistant built atop Copilot and an organization’s internal codebase. Engineers benefit from domain-specific adapters that enforce code style, security guidelines, and architecture patterns. The system uses retrieval to pull API docs and in-repo guidelines, while few-shot prompts shape how the assistant explains decisions, suggests improvements, or refactors code. The combination of adapters for domain constraints and retrieval for current docs results in a smoother coding experience, fewer missteps, and better alignment with company standards. It also demonstrates how few-shot adaptation scales across tasks: one base model, multiple domain adapters, and a unified inference path with a retrieval augmentation layer.


In the creative and media space, multimodal platforms such as Midjourney—when guided by brand guidelines and asset inventories—apply few-shot prompts to adapt style, color palettes, and composition rules to a client’s needs. Retrieval components can fetch mood boards or brand manuals to ensure generated imagery remains on-brand, while adapters handle domain-specific style cues. For audio and video, OpenAI Whisper pipelines paired with few-shot prompting can transcribe and summarize content while respecting privacy constraints and corporate terminologies. The result is a cohesive, brand-consistent output across channels, achieved with a blend of few-shot prompting, retrieval augmentation, and lightweight domain adaptation.


Another compelling use case is knowledge-grounded assistants in regulated industries. A legal tech or healthcare assistant can use few-shot prompts to interpret questions, fetch relevant statutes or guidelines, and present user-friendly summaries with disclaimers. The system’s design emphasizes correctness, auditability, and safety: retrieval anchors facts, adapters encode domain expectations, and prompts guide the reasoning and presentation. While the model can generate fluent responses, the retrieval layer ensures accuracy and currency, which is crucial for risk-sensitive environments and for maintaining user trust. This is the kind of deployment where few-shot adaptation shines—offering domain fidelity without sacrificing generality, speed, or safety.


In every case, the core lesson is that few-shot adaptation is not a single trick but a design pattern: combine prompt strategy, lightweight task-specific tuning, and retrieval to create flexible, scalable systems. The emphasis is on practical trade-offs—latency vs. accuracy, personalization vs. privacy, offline adaptation vs. online learning—that determine whether a solution succeeds in the real world. It’s this balance that underpins successful deployments of products like Copilot, Midjourney, and Whisper-based workflows, where the system must be both capable and controllable across diverse user contexts.


Future Outlook

The field will continue to evolve toward more seamless and privacy-preserving forms of adaptation. Dynamic adapters that can be loaded on demand, refreshed with continuous integration pipelines, and rolled out per customer or per domain will become standard. We’ll see smarter retrieval strategies, where the system learns what sources to trust, how to cite them, and how to combine multiple sources into a coherent answer without overloading the prompt. Meta-learning that tunes prompting and retrieval behaviors across related tasks will enable faster onboarding of new capabilities with less human annotation. The frontier is not just bigger models; it’s smarter composition—where you orchestrate prompts, adapters, and retrieval in a way that respects latency budgets, costs, and governance constraints.


In production, expect more robust safety and evaluation frameworks. Systems will routinely run adversarial testing on prompts, monitor for prompt leakage, and employ automated red-teaming to catch edge cases. We’ll also see more emphasis on multi-modal adaptation: adapting not only text but also images, audio, and structured data through coherent, cross-modal prompts and retrieval pipelines. This will empower products to generate brand-consistent visuals, captions, and summaries that align with user intent and policy constraints. The practical implication for engineers is to invest in modular architectures, clear versioning for prompts and adapters, and automation that can verify alignment with business rules across updates and regulatory changes.


Finally, broader industry adoption will hinge on accessible tooling and measurable ROI. Parameter-efficient methods, like LoRA or adapters, will democratize customization by lowering costs and speeding iteration cycles. Vector stores will become core data infrastructure components, tightly integrated with monitoring dashboards and governance controls. As AI systems become more capable, the demand for transparent, controllable, and auditable adaptations will intensify—driving best practices in data curation, prompt design, and cross-team collaboration between product, data science, and engineering roles. This convergence—technical rigor, product-minded experimentation, and responsible deployment—defines the next era of few-shot adaptation in real-world AI.


Conclusion

Few-shot adaptation techniques offer a practical, scalable path from broad AI capabilities to domain-specific, production-ready behavior. By combining strong prompting strategies with lightweight, trainable adapters and retrieval-augmented generation, teams can tailor models to brand voice, policy requirements, and up-to-date knowledge without the costs and risks of full fine-tuning. The real power lies in the system-level design: modular components, clear data pipelines, robust evaluation, and proactive governance that together turn theoretical potential into reliable, user-focused solutions. As you prototype and deploy, you’ll learn where to invest in prompts, where to invest in adapters, and where retrieval provides the biggest lift—and you’ll gain a playbook that travels from a single, promising experiment to an ecosystem of capabilities across products and domains. The journey from concept to production is iterative, but with disciplined design, it becomes a repeatable pattern rather than a one-off leap.


Avichala is committed to guiding learners and professionals through this journey—bridging applied AI, generative AI, and real-world deployment insights with hands-on clarity. We invite you to explore these ideas, experiment in your own projects, and join a global community dedicated to practical AI mastery. Learn more at www.avichala.com.